def sum(a:int,b:int=100) ->int:
a = 200
return a+b
if __name__ == '__main__':
c = sum(a=0)
print(c)
其实函数参数中的冒号是参数的类型建议符,告诉程序员希望传入的实参的类型。函数后面跟着的箭头是函数返回值的类型建议符,用来说明该函数返回的值是什么类型。
值得注意的是,类型建议符并非强制规定和检查,也就是说即使传入的实际参数与建议参数不符,也不会报错
本文介绍了Python中函数参数的类型建议符及其作用,指出它们非强制性且不引发错误。示例中展示了如何定义带默认值的函数`sum`,并调用它来计算结果。虽然输入参数与建议类型不符,但程序仍能正常运行。
def sum(a:int,b:int=100) ->int:
a = 200
return a+b
if __name__ == '__main__':
c = sum(a=0)
print(c)
其实函数参数中的冒号是参数的类型建议符,告诉程序员希望传入的实参的类型。函数后面跟着的箭头是函数返回值的类型建议符,用来说明该函数返回的值是什么类型。
值得注意的是,类型建议符并非强制规定和检查,也就是说即使传入的实际参数与建议参数不符,也不会报错
451
2522
9530
8045

被折叠的 条评论
为什么被折叠?